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ong
The NM_006961.4(ZNF19):āc.1196A>Gā(p.Asn399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000266 in 1,613,836 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ā ).

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Nov 13, 2024 | The c.1196A>G (p.N399S) alteration is located in exon 6 (coding exon 4) of the ZNF19 gene. This alteration results from a A to G substitution at nucleotide position 1196, causing the asparagine (N) at amino acid position 399 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
